Would you have framed the study differently? If so, how?

Obviously, the situation would have been framed differently. The way that this should have occurred, is through talking about the events and the effect they are having on various stakeholders. This is accomplished by discussing the case in logical manner and pointing out what factors contributed to the problem. (Asmussen, n.d., pp. 337 -- 352)

Once this takes place, is when there will be a discussion about how to effectively create an appropriate response plan and what factors must be taken into consideration.
During this process, there will be an examination of what tools have worked successfully for other organizations and their possible impact on the college. Then, there will be a discussion about how to: properly prepare everyone for identifying and responding to the early warning signs. (Asmussen, n.d., pp. 337 -- 352)

If this kind of approach had been utilized, it would have helped everyone to see how to create a strategy that can deal with these emerging threats. This is when these ideas can be used as a foundation for learning from this event and mitigating future incidents. Over the course of time, this would have given everyone a sense of understanding the various challenges they are dealing with. (Asmussen, n.d., pp. 337 -- 352)

Once this takes place, is the point that different stakeholders will see the need for making these changes. This is when they can begin to have a positive impact on the world around them by: implementing guidelines that identify the problem and dealing with it (while these issues are small). When this happens, the odds of seeing some kind of gunman on campus will be reduced. This will improve security and help everyone to move forward in the aftermath of these events.
